Spring Fits: Breezy Layers and Crisp Colorways

Spring is arguably the best season for styling Jordans because temperate weather enables the widest range of outfit combinations. Begin with the Air Jordan 1 Mid in a pastel or earth-tone colorway — selections like “Craft Clay” or “Sage Green” complement nicely casual-cut chinos in khaki or olive. Throw on a lightweight crewneck sweatshirt in a understated color over a fresh white oxford shirt, letting the collar poke through for refined casual appeal. For a street-style-driven spring ensemble, try the Jordan 4 in a lighter colorway with narrow cargo pants and an oversized graphic tee, completing the look with an casual coach jacket. The essential rule of spring styling is making sure your palette flows — grab one accent color from the shoe and carry it somewhere in your outfit. Hemmed or cuffed trousers look fantastic because they showcase the sneaker and give your outfit a thoughtful quality. Spring is also the best time to introduce fresh pairs, since low humidity lessens weather-related damage risk.

Summer Styling: Staying Fresh in Your Js

Rocking Jordans in summer calls for a change in approach because the objective is beating the heat without giving up fashion punch. The Air Jordan 1 Low is the absolute ruler of summer Jordan style — its low-cut profile matches flawlessly with shorts, and colorways like “UNC,” “Bred Toe,” and “Mocha” suit virtually nike jordans any warm-weather outfit. Pair your AJ1 Lows with 7-inch inseam athletic shorts or well-cut chino shorts in understated hues, and hold the top half understated with a flattering solid tee or a lightweight camp collar shirt. If you enjoy high-tops in summer, the Jordan 1 High looks good with baggier shorts that hang just above the knee, creating a well-proportioned silhouette. For head-turning summer style, try Jordan 5s or Jordan 6s with mesh basketball shorts and a vintage-washed oversized tee. Socks are crucial — ankle socks keep the look clean with low-tops, while crew socks with delicate accents provide visual interest with high-tops. Avoid the mistake of wearing dress shorts or excessively refined summer clothing with Jordans, as the contrast looks confused rather than deliberate.

Fall Fits: Earth Tones and Layering Time

Fall is arguably the most versatile season for Jordan styling, as chillier weather invite layers, textures, and warm palettes that seamlessly match legendary Jordan colorways. The Air Jordan 3 “Mocha” or “Palomino” styled with dark selvedge denim and a flannel shirt delivers tough but sophisticated energy that looks great from countryside visits to urban hangouts. Lead with a snug long-sleeve tee, add a sturdy flannel or corduroy overshirt, and top with a insulated vest or waxed canvas jacket for style depth. The Jordan 12 in darker colorways like “Royalty” becomes a focal point when styled alongside slim-fit black jeans and a crew neck sweater in burgundy, forest green, or camel. Joggers are fantastic fall pairings, especially tapered tech fleece styles that land perfectly above the shoe without stacking messily. For a dressed-up fall fit, pair Jordan 1 Highs with tailored wool trousers and a bomber jacket — deliberate contrast that style-conscious dressers target. Fall colorways in rich shades inherently work alongside the season’s clothing essentials.

Cold-Weather Looks: Chilly Days, Sharp Looks

Dressing in Jordans during winter brings special obstacles: you demand warmth and climate resistance, all while maintaining style despite layered clothing. Tall Jordan models are your greatest allies in cold weather, with the Jordan 1 High, Jordan 12, and Jordan 13 all giving ankle warmth that helps keep the cold out. A traditional winter outfit opens with a substantial hoodie or turtleneck sweater finished with a padded jacket or lined parka. For bottoms, straight-cut jeans in dark washes drape well over high-top Jordans, producing a sharp break line. Black-on-black outfits stand out in winter — Jordan 1 “Shadow” or “Triple Black” with black slim jeans and a non-shiny black puffer produces stealth-mode style. If you live where snow and slush are typical, select leather-upper Jordans as opposed to suede, and apply waterproofing spray before facing the elements. Wool trousers in charcoal or navy contribute polished winter appeal that harmonizes with the Jordan 12 and a topcoat.

Event-Specific Looks: From Low-Key to Romantic Evening

Beyond seasons, understanding how to style Jordans for different settings elevates your look to a level most guys never reach. For laid-back Saturday plans, go easy with Jordan Lows, flattering joggers, and a spotless hoodie, emphasizing comfort over exactness. Work settings with relaxed dress codes create an opportunity — pair Jordan 1 Lows or Jordan 3s in neutral colorways with well-cut chinos and a fresh button-down, avoiding loud colorways. Date nights call for deliberate styling — the Jordan 1 High “Chicago” with black slim jeans, a crisp white tee, and a slim leather jacket exudes confidence, and women regularly rank polished sneaker looks among the most eye-catching casual looks according to GQ. Live music events are perfect for bold colorways that feel too loud for everyday wear. Travel outfits are greatly improved by Jordans because they fuse walking comfort with style that is photogenic. The flexibility across occasions is one of Air Jordans’ most valuable strengths, unleashed when you coordinate the shoe character to the occasion vibe.

Creating a Comprehensive Jordan Rotation

You do not require 50 pairs to stay stylish year-round — four to six strategically chosen pairs address every season and occasion. Open with two foundational pairs: a Jordan 1 Low in a versatile colorway for warm weather, and a Jordan 1 High in a iconic colorway for fall and winter. Add one conversation-starter pair like the Jordan 4 “Military Blue” as a ice breaker. A performance-lifestyle crossover like the Luka 3 handles gym days. To round things out, one pair in earthy earthy tones caps off your rotation with a fall-ready option most worn in fall and winter. This five-pair rotation, approximately $700 to $900 at 2026 retail, ensures comprehensive coverage. The essential rule is fighting the urge to buy five pairs in the same color family — variety across silhouettes, heights, and palettes guarantees your rotation never gets monotonous, as endorsed by styling experts at Highsnobiety.
